Jamshedpur: Three water dispensing machines have been installed on Tatanagar railway station’s platforms one and two to make life simpler for travelers. Ranchi Legislator CP Singh inaugurated these machines formally on Tuesday by cutting a ribbon.

Passengers may purchase one litre of cold and clean drinking water only for Rs 5.

Platform No. 2 has a single machine, whereas Platform No. 1 has two machines installed. Later, commenting on this new facility, Ranchi MLA CP Singh emphasized the significance of water for passengers and stated that this move will benefit them significantly.

Later, CP Singh, a Ranchi Legislator and former Jharkhand Assembly Speaker, also questioned the current state government’s management of law and order soon after the inauguration ceremony of vending machines at Tatanagar railway station.

According to Singh, criminals in the state have gained confidence, and the general populace is fearful.

He also accused the state government of being more concerned with public relations than with people’s safety.

Singh also stated that the BJP and AJSU parties have joined forces in the next Ramgarh by-election, and that the public would utilize this chance to express their unhappiness with the current government by voting against it.
